Plain-English summary
Landowner Protection Act of 2011 - Amends the Federal Power Act to prohibit the Federal Energy Regulatory Commission (FERC) from requiring removal or modification of any existing nonconforming structure or encroachment within the project boundary, except one built in bad faith, whenever it issues, denies, approves, or modifies a mandatory shoreline management plan required under a FERC license.
